Junior (2014):

Hannigan started all 18 games he played in during his junior season, recording career-best marks in nearly every statistical category.  He finished the year with eight shutouts (tied for the second-most by an Eagle in a single-season), a 12-4-2 record, and a 0.63 goals-against average (the fourth-lowest ever by an Eagle and the 32nd-best mark in Division III in 2014).  He yielded just 12 goals and made 49 saves for a .803 save percentage (104th-best in D-III), while playing a career-high 1,701 minutes and seven seconds.  Hannigan was named the University Athletic Association (UAA) Athlete of the Week on September 8th, after recording back-to-back shutouts against Ohio Northern and Ramampo College.  Twice during the season, he recorded three-straight shutouts – against Berry College, Birmingham-Southern College and the University of the South from September 20th – 27th, and against the University of Rochester, Case Western Reserve University and Carnegie Mellon University from October 31st – November 8th.  He made a season-high seven saves during a 2-1 double-overtime win against Oglethorpe University on October 1st.  Hannigan will enter his senior season at Emory tied for third in the program’s history with 32 wins, just 13 short of the Emory career record.  He is also third in school history with 17 career shutouts (four behind the school record), eighth with 142 saves and a 0.98 goals-against average, and 12th with a .736 save percentage.

Sophomore (2013):

Hannigan earned the first postseason honor of his career, as the sophomore was named to the all-University Athletic Association (UAA) Second Team for his performance during the 2013 campaign.  He played every minute of the Eagles’ conference matches, leading all UAA goalkeepers with a 0.81 goals-against average, a .846 save percentage, three shutouts and 33 saves in conference play.  Overall, Hannigan started all of the Eagles’ 18 games and played 1,646 minutes, sitting for just 14 minutes during the season.  He finished the year with an 11-5-2 record and six individual shutouts (tied for the seventh-most in school history), while notching a 1.09 goals-against average, the 131st-best mark in Division III.  Hannigan turned away 62 of the 82 shots on goal during the campaign for a .756 save percentage, ranking 198th among D-III keepers.  He recorded a season-high six saves on three occasions, coming on October 20th against Brandeis University, November 1st against the University of Rochester, and November 9th against Carnegie Mellon University, with each opponent ranked nationally at the time of the game.  His three conference shutouts came at the University of Chicago on October 12th, against New York University on October 18th and at Case Western Reserve on November 3rd, in addition to non-conference clean sheets against Mississippi College (September 1st), at Guilford College (September 8th) and against Millsaps College (September 28th).  He was named the UAA Defensive Athlete of the Week on October 14th and October 21st.  Through his two seasons on the team, Hannigan ranks eighth in school history with 20 wins, ninth with nine shutouts, 10th with a 1.18 GAA, 12th with 93 saves and 13th with a .705 save percentage.

Freshman (2012):

Hannigan became the first Emory freshman to start a game in goal since Derek Marinatos did so as a red shirt in 1995, and the first true freshman to start in goal since Brian Smith in 1991.  Taking over the starting goalkeeper duties seven games into the campaign and holding it the rest of the way, Hannigan finished the year with a 9-4-1 overall record, recording a 1.29 goals-against average and a .620 save percentage.  Two of his three shutouts in 2012 came in key conference games at the end of the season, with a pair of 1-0 wins over New York University and Carnegie Mellon University in back-to-back weeks.  Hannigan recorded a career-best seven saves in his starting debut at Berry College on September 15th, and finished the year with 31 saves.

Prior to Emory:

Played on the Hendrick Hudson High School team for four seasons, serving as the team captain during his senior year... Earned all-section honors during his junior and senior campaigns... Was coached in high school by Chris Cassidy.. Was played club soccer for FC Westchester, where he was coached by Eddie Quiroga.

Personal:

Born September 2nd, 1994... Was selected to his high school's honor roll... Also played lacrosse in high school.
